FlyQuest had an amazing 2020, making it through to the NA Finals in a row both spring and summer, qualifying for the worlds time for the first time in the organization’s history. At Worlds, FlyQuest sat in a group with one of the world’s favorites, Top Esports, along with LCK’s second seed, DRX and Unicorns of Love. FlyQuest annoyed TES at the end of their trip and brought them the only loss in the group stage, but despite 3: 3 they could not even qualify for a tiebreaker. In the 11th. Season, FlyQuest has reportedly replaced all five members. Here is the current rumored FlyQuest 2021 roster.

Verified player signatures are green. Confirmed players leaving are crossed out in red. Broadcasts reported by reputable sources are in purple.

If these signatures are all confirmed, this will be the second major signing by Cloud9 players in a row after Evil Geniuses signed four last year (including Matthew « Deftly » Chen). . This large C9 buyout includes star top laner Eric « Licorice » Ritchie and the C9 Academy Mid, Cristian « Palafox » Palafox and Academy support David « Diamond » Bérubé. Flyquest is also rumored to be buying up Rainbow7s jungler Brandon « Josedeodo » Villegas. Eventually they are rumored to be signing the former EG Academy AD Carry Deftly, which will be returning to some of its former C9 members from 2019. Jacob Wolf reported that FlyQuest is still in the AD carry market, which could potentially mean Deftly ends up as FLY Academy AD. This would mean that the entire FlyQuest roster would be changed when all of the signatures went through.

UPDATE 11/17: Travis Gafford has reported that Dignitas will be trading with AD « Carry Johnson » Johnsun « Nguyen on FlyQuest. Should this deal come off, Johnsun would be the expected starter for FLY, which would bring Deftly to the FLY Academy. Longtime FlyQuest AD wear, Jason « Wildturtle » Trans, future is currently unknown.

Jacob Wolf soon confirmed Gafford’s report, stating that Johnsun would start for FlyQuest over Deftly, the latter reportedly being acquired as part of the deal that sent Lee « IgNar » Dong-geun from FLY to Evil Geniuses.
